Plumbing cost by service.
Typical price ranges for the seven plumbing jobs homeowners book most often, adjusted for Valrico labor and code. Linked services have a dedicated city guide.
- 01General plumber service call$75 – $200
- 02Hourly plumber rate$45 – $150 / hour
- 03Water heater replacement →tank vs tankless$800 – $3,500
- 04Sewer line replacement →traditional or trenchless$3,000 – $25,000
- 05Whole-house repiping →PEX or copper$3,000 – $15,000
- 06Drain line replacement →interior or main$1,000 – $8,000
- 07Emergency plumbing service$150 – $500
* Ranges adjusted for Valrico's tier and median income — verify with an on-site quote.

Why Plumbing Costs Vary in Valrico
Several factors unique to Valrico affect plumbing costs. The humid subtropical climate can cause faster corrosion of pipes and fixtures, especially in older homes. Many homes in the area sit on sandy soil, which can shift and stress underground lines, leading to slab leaks or sewer line issues. Florida's state plumbing code requires licensed plumbers to follow specific materials and installation methods, which can influence labor time and material choices. The local labor market also plays a role; demand for skilled plumbers in the Tampa Bay region can affect rates. Finally, permit fees from the local building department add to the total cost, though they ensure work is up to code. Each job's complexity—such as accessing pipes in tight crawlspaces or dealing with hard water deposits—further tailors the final price.
Common Plumbing Issues in Valrico Homes
- 1
Slab Leaks
Valrico's sandy soil can shift, causing concrete slabs to settle and crack water lines underneath. This is a frequent issue in homes built on slabs, requiring specialized detection and repair.
- 2
Clogged Drains from Hard Water
Florida's hard water leads to mineral buildup in pipes, especially in older Valrico neighborhoods. This reduces flow and can cause stubborn clogs that need professional clearing.
- 3
Water Heater Failure
Humidity and hard water shorten the lifespan of water heaters in Valrico. Sediment accumulation and rust are common, often requiring replacement after 8-12 years.
- 4
Sewer Line Blockages
Tree roots seeking moisture in Valrico's sandy soil can invade sewer lines, causing backups. Older homes with clay pipes are especially vulnerable.
- 5
Fixture Leaks from Humidity
High humidity can deteriorate seals and gaskets in faucets and toilets, leading to persistent drips. This is common in bathrooms and outdoor spigots.

Do I need a permit for plumbing work in Valrico?
Yes, for major work like water heater replacement, repiping, or sewer line repairs, your local building department typically requires a permit. The plumber usually handles this, and the cost is included in the estimate. Permits ensure the work meets Florida's plumbing code and passes inspection.
